The Biochemical Incubator 100L-400L YR02039-1 // YR02039-4 is a sophisticated piece of equipment designed for precise control of temperature and humidity, catering to a variety of scientific and research needs. This incubator is essential for BOD determination of water and serves critical roles in sectors such as environmental protection, health, and scientific research. Its world-renowned compressor and advanced PID control systems ensure stability and efficiency, making it ideal for cell culture, microbial testing, and plant growth experiments. Compliant with global standards like the FDA, AS3350, and others, it excels in long-term and accelerated testing applications. Key Features

  • Forced convection for uniform temperature distribution.
  • Advanced PID control system for precise temperature management.
  • Temperature accuracy of 0.1℃ and stability of ±0.5℃.
  • Spacious interior volumes ranging from 100L to 400L.
  • Energy-efficient design with environmentally friendly refrigerants.
  • Ergonomic, user-friendly operation with an integrated LCD display.
